Common Myths About Refractive Lens Exchange
When it concerns refractive lens exchange (RLE), lots of people keep misconceptions that can shadow their understanding of the procedure.
One typical myth is that RLE is just for older adults, however it can profit younger people with extreme refractive errors.
An additional false impression is that RLE resembles cataract surgical treatment, yet both procedures have various goals and techniques.
Some people bother with the healing time, thinking it'll take weeks, when most individuals return to normal tasks within a few days.
You could also hear that RLE is too dangerous, however modern advancements have made it a safe option for lots of.
It's crucial to different fact from fiction to make educated choices about your vision improvement alternatives.

Advantages and Dangers of RLE
After comprehending the RLE procedure, it is very important to evaluate the benefits and dangers connected with it.
One major benefit is the capacity for boosted vision, enabling you to reduce or eliminate the requirement for glasses or get in touch with lenses. Several patients experience enhanced quality of life and higher liberty in day-to-day activities.
Nevertheless, like any kind of surgery, RLE lugs dangers. Complications can consist of infection, retinal detachment, or vision changes that may not be correctable. There's additionally the possibility of requiring additional procedures.
It's vital to have a complete discussion with your eye treatment expert concerning your particular scenario. By weighing these factors carefully, you can make an enlightened choice regarding whether RLE is the best selection for you.
